Learn vogen Learn how to use vogen with Shoulder.dev Value Object Fundamentals Vogen's Features and Benefits Vogen Configuration Integration with Frameworks and Libraries Performance and Optimization Value Object Design Patterns Code Analysis and Error Handling Advanced Value Object Concepts Migration from Primitive Types to Value Objects Best Practices and Common Use Cases Codebase Learn the codebase to contribute to vogen